About This Item
Lee and Shepard, 1875. Hardcover. Good. Marbled paper and burgundy leather boards are worn at the edges, paper is scuffed, top inch of spine is torn, head/tail quite worn, surface is scuffed. Inside cover has a library & literary Association bookplate and small store sticker, front hinge weak, frontis is loose in book, embossed seal on title page, paper tanned with age.
